Output 52190463936b6c929a3eb462eb7cdb30ee80a9e210b3f7264c18e7e2939b5fcc:0

value
176805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dbf89920102f8ce6388854dde4316d95229ad5c OP_EQUAL
address
3QpiLKxKYESRWzib84vzZrAcH7UKA3XkxT
transaction
52190463936b6c929a3eb462eb7cdb30ee80a9e210b3f7264c18e7e2939b5fcc
spent
true